I'm curious about the optional excursions. How well are they priced? 

 

Optional tours always seem expensive, but here's what we paid for the ones we took:

Lerwick-"Ancient Civilizations of the Shetlands,"  $99, 4 hr.

Edinburgh-"Holyrood Palace & Edinburgh Castle,"  $159, 7.5 hr.  (includes fairly expensive entrance fees to both)

Belfast-"Giant's Causeway", $99, 5.5 hr.  (includes another fairly expensive entrance fee-the Visitors' Center and round trip ride                           from there to the scenic area

Liverpool-"Roman City of Chester," $169, 7.5 hr.  (includes lunch)

Dover-"Canterbury Cathedral and Leeds Castle," $179, 8 hr.  (includes both entry fees and ride on the little train from/to parking

                    area)

London-"London & the London Eye," $169, 2.5 hr.  (includes fee to ride London Eye)
